Jon Edgar is an artist using improvisation in his carving practice. He has a contrasting body of closely observed clay heads of prominent and interesting sitters. You can see public works at Lewes (Grange Gardens), at Pulborough (entrance road to RSPB Pulborough Brooks) and Hindhead (Devil’s Punch Bowl). A recent work on the South Downs at Slindon, now finished is written up as ‘A South Downs Year‘.
